A leading airline in Europe is seeking a Training Administrator in Stansted. The successful candidate will coordinate trainee programmes, ensuring their planning, delivery, and onboarding are conducted effectively.
Strong communication and planning skills are essential, along with the ability to adapt quickly and work under pressure. Previous experience with UK apprenticeships is preferred. Applicants must hold a valid UK/EU passport and be willing to travel as required.
